Cryptocurrency Market Dynamics: ETH Breaks $5,000 Amid Regulatory Clarity and Institutional Moves

Ether surged past the $5,000 mark, driven by technical breakthroughs, a favorable macroeconomic climate, and clearer regulatory frameworks. The milestone underscores growing institutional confidence in digital assets, with Bitmine Technologies adding 264,378 ETH to its reserves, now holding over 2% of Ether's total supply.

Market volatility resurfaced on September 22, 2025, as liquidations hit $1.9 billion. ETH briefly retreated to $4,075—a 9% drop—triggering $506 million in long liquidations. Institutional activity partially offset the sell-off, highlighting the market's maturing risk-rebalance mechanisms.

XRP Price Prediction Post-October 2025 ETF Approvals

The crypto market braces for a potential seismic shift as the SEC approaches critical deadlines for multiple ETF applications, including those for XRP. Analysts warn of an impending supply shock, with exchange-held XRP reserves plummeting to historic lows. Coinbase's XRP inventory alone has dwindled by nearly 90%, now hovering around 100 million tokens.

Institutional demand could collide with retail reluctance in what some are calling a perfect storm for price appreciation. Unlike Bitcoin's ETF debut, where early inflows set records, XRP's scenario appears fundamentally different. Retail investors typically hold for the long term, with cost bases between $0.20 and $3, creating what Jake Claver describes as a 'diamond hands' scenario. Market makers may need to push prices toward $10 or beyond to unlock meaningful supply.

The mechanics of spot ETFs could force institutional buyers to compete for scarce liquidity. With $5-$8 billion potentially flooding into XRP ETFs within the first month, price discovery could become volatile. The market hasn't forgotten Bitcoin's ETF-induced rally, but XRP's unique supply dynamics suggest a different playbook—one where altcoins like Solana and Litecoin may ride the coattails of institutional capital rotation.

SEC Accelerates Altcoin ETF Approvals Ahead of New Listing Standards

The U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ission has taken a decisive step toward streamlining cryptocurrency ETF approvals. Regulatory delays for Solana, XRP, Hedera, Litecoin, and Cardano investment products were abruptly withdrawn just days before updated listing standards take effect.

Market participants interpreted the move as a potential shift in the SEC's approach to digital asset ETFs. Bitwise, VanEck, and Fidelity were among the firms benefiting from the withdrawn delay notices on solana products. Similar reprieves came for XRP ETFs from Franklin Templeton and WisdomTree, while Canary saw obstacles removed for its Hedera and Litecoin offerings.

The timing suggests strategic positioning by regulators ahead of October deadline expirations. This development follows the commission's recent adoption of revised cryptocurrency ETF listing frameworks, though questions remain about final approval timelines for these alternative asset products.

16 Crypto ETFs Await SEC Approval in October: Major Decisions Ahead

The U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ission is poised to deliver verdicts on 16 cryptocurrency exchange-traded funds this month, with rulings spanning major altcoins including Solana, XRP, Litecoin and Dogecoin. The regulatory gauntlet begins October 2 with Canary's proposed Litecoin ETF—a bellwether decision that could set precedent for subsequent approvals.

Grayscale's bid to convert its Solana and Litecoin trusts into spot ETFs faces scrutiny on October 10, while WisdomTree's XRP ETF proposal reaches its make-or-break moment on October 24. These decisions arrive as institutional demand for crypto exposure grows increasingly difficult to ignore—despite regulators' historical reluctance.

Market participants are parsing each deadline as a potential catalyst, particularly for mid-cap altcoins that could see liquidity surges from ETF inflows. The concentrated approval schedule suggests October may become a watershed month for digital asset adoption in traditional finance.
